Tripod Meets Logitech Webcam

To disassemble the QuickCam, first you have to remove the rubber foot at the rear of the webcam's base. This conceals two additional screws holding the base halves together. The screws are very small and a micro screwdriver was needed.

Be sure to keep the adhesive of the rubber pad clean so it can be reattached during reassembly.

I've removed the webcam from the base to keep it from getting damaged while modifying the base. The webcam sphere can be removed by simply pulling away from the base and it will detached from the pivot stem.
